ホームページ >バックエンド開発 >PHPチュートリアル >ドメイン名が www から非 www にジャンプする、2 つの解決策: Apache と Nginx
背景: www は非 www にジャンプします。
http://www.jiutianniao.com と http://jiutianniao.com の両方にアクセスできます。
ただし、www を www 以外にリダイレクトしたい場合は、入力して検索エンジンに同じ Web サイトとして扱わせる方が簡単です。
2 つの解決策:
1.Apache:
プロジェクト jiutianniao の下に新しい「.htaccess」ファイルを作成します。
RewriteEngine On
RewriteCond %{HTTP_HOST} ^www.jiutianniao.com
RewriteRule (.*) http://jiutianniao.com/$1 [R=301,L]
2.Nginx:
server{
37 }server_name www.fansunion.cn;
38 return 301 $scheme://fansunion.cn$request_uri;
39 }
40 server {
41 listen 80;
42 サーバー名fansunion .cn;
43
49 charset utf-8;
50 access_log off;
51
52 ssi on;
53 ssi_silent_errors on;
54
55 ロケーション / {
56 proxy_pass http : //localhost:8888;
57 }
58
59 }
参考: http://langui.me/2010/11/apache-www-to-non-www/
----- ------------------------------------------------- --- --------------------
武漢九天娘-P2Pオンラインローンシステム開発-インターネットアプリケーションソフトウェア開発
会社公式ウェブサイト: http://jiutianniao.com
ソーシャル Q&A: http://ask.jiutianniao.com上記では、www から非 www へのドメイン名ジャンプの 2 つの解決策 (Apache と Nginx) を、関連する内容も含めて紹介しています。PHP チュートリアルに興味のある友人にとって役立つことを願っています。